Your CTC is split into Base Pay & Flexible pay. While base pay attracts PF & Gratuity deductions, flexi pay has to be opted by you. It is suggested to request the following components in the flexi pay.

1. Conveyance Allowance - Rs.800/- P.m. (no proof is required, fully tax exempted)

2.Medical Assistance - Rs.1250/-p.m (tax exempted subject to production of bills)

3.Children Edu Allowance - Rs.100/- per child /month (max 2 children) - Tax exempted (bills to be produced)

4. LTA - If you opt for LTA, it is tax exempted twice in a block years of 4 yrs. You have to avail min 6 days PL and produce the train/air tkts for self and dependents for claiming tax benefit. If you are not undertaking the travel, the LTA amount will be paid to you at the end of the year and the amount thus received will be treated as taxable income. LTA is not paid on monthly basis.

5.50% of basic can be claimed as HRA (for metros) or 40% of basic (for non-metros) for claiming tax benefit.

You can get LTA only if you have applied for leave from your company and have actually travelled. However, international travel is not valid.
Only the travel costs are covered. So, whether you fly, hop on to a train or take public transport, you will have to show the ticket to claim your LTA.
LTA covers travel for yourself and your family. Family, in this case, includes yourself, parents, siblings dependent on you, spouse (even if your spouse is working) and children.
You can claim the LTA benefit just once in a year.
If you switch jobs, you can get the LTA not only from your present organisation but also from your former employer, if the concession is lying unutilized.
You must take the shortest route to your destination to be eligible for LTA.
If your LTA is not utilized, it gets added to your salary and you will be taxed on it.

Conveyance allowance is totally different from LTA. 9600 will be totally excluded from your taxable income. You need to produce only rent receipts for HRA and for claiming tax exemption. Don't exclude HRA.
Food coupons upto 2750/- p.m. is fully tax exempted. Go for it. All dept stores are accepting the food coupons for exchange of groceries and eatables in addition to select restaurents.
